Smith County Football loses to Sequatchie Co. on the road

September 28, 2018

The Smith County Owls were unable to break their losing streak, losing on the road to the Sequatchie County Indians 41-21.

Smith County went down by a touchdown early, but were able to bounce back with a score of their own to tie the game at 7-7. Sequatchie County bounced back with a score of their own before the end of the first quarter to take a 14-7 lead. The Owls tied it back up at 14, but the Indians were able to score again to take a 21-14 lead into halftime.

The Indians pulled away in the fourth quarter, going up 34-14 before the Owls were able to score a touchdown. Sequatchie County bounced back to take a 41-21 lead, to wrap up the scoring for the game and drop the Owls to 1-5 on the year.
